What is IoT Software for Linux?

Internet of Things (IoT) software is a form of technology that allows for connected devices to communicate with each other over the internet. It generally consists of various hardware and software components such as sensors, wireless networks, and databases. With the help of IoT software, data can be collected from multiple sources for further analysis and it can also be used to control devices remotely. IoT software also offers advantages such as improved efficiency and better security for connected devices.     Azure Digital Twins
    Azure Digital Twins is an Internet of Things (IoT) platform that enables you to create a digital representation of real-world things, places, business processes, and people. Gain insights that help you drive better products, optimize operations and costs, and create breakthrough customer experiences. Easily model and create digital representations of connected environments with an open modeling language. Model buildings, factories, farms, energy networks, railways, stadiums—even entire cities. Bring these digital twins to life with a live execution environment that historizes twin changes over time. Unlock actionable insights into the behavior of modeled environments via powerful query APIs, and integrates with Azure data analytics. Open modeling language to create custom domain models of any connected environment using Digital Twins Definition Language.

    Bosch IoT Suite
    With Bosch IoT Suite you can create abstract representations of real-world assets or devices in the cloud. These digital twins comprise all the capabilities and aspects of their physical counterparts. By storing and updating the data, properties, and relationships of an asset and providing notifications of all relevant changes they allow you to keep the real and digital worlds in sync.
